Wyszukiwarki internetowe

Przeglądarka internetowa lub przeglądarka WWW - program komputerowy służący do pobierania i wyświetlania stron internetowych udostępnianych przez serwery WWW, a także odtwarzania plików multimedialnych, często przy użyciu dodatkowych rozszerzeń, zwanych wtyczkami.

 

Przeglądarki internetowe komunikują się z serwerem zazwyczaj za pomocą protokołu HTTP, aczkolwiek w obsłudze są również inne, np. HTTPS, FTP, Gopher. Często wraz z przeglądarką dostarczane są komponenty, które umożliwiają korzystanie z serwerów grup dyskusyjnych (protokół NNTP), poczty elektronicznej (protokoły POP3, IMAP i SMTP) oraz serwerów plików (protokół FTP).

Trwająca na rynku wojna przeglądarek powoduje, że oprogramowanie do przeglądania stron WWW cały czas ewoluuje w stronę większej ergonomii, użyteczności i wygody użytkownika. Nowoczesne przeglądarki spełniają szereg wymagań – za dobry poziom uznawana jest obecnie obsługa następujących technologii:

·        HTTP i HTTPS

·        HTML, XML i XHTML

·        grafika w formatach: GIF, JPEG, PNG z obsługą półprzezroczystości oraz SVG

·        kaskadowe arkusze stylów (CSS)

·        JavaScript (w tym DHTML)

·        obiektowy model dokumentu (DOM)

·        ciasteczka

·        Adobe Flash

·        aplety Java

Oprócz tego, rozwijane są następujące funkcje ułatwiające korzystanie z Internetu:

·        zakładki (ulubione)

·        menedżery pobierania plików

·        przechowywanie plików w pamięci podręcznej

·        obsługa wtyczek (rozszerzeń)

·        obsługa skórek (motywów), możliwość dostosowania interfejsu do preferencji i potrzeb użytkownika

·        przeglądanie w kartach

·        zapamiętywanie haseł

·        gesty myszy i skróty klawiaturowe

·        blokowanie wyskakujących okienek

·        zarządzanie prywatnymi danymi (ciasteczka, historia odwiedzin, dane formularzy, hasła itp.)

·        sprawdzanie poprawności pisowni (formularze, listy elektroniczne itp.)

·        filtry reklam

·        powiększanie tekstu, grafik lub całej zawartości strony

·        wbudowane programy do obsługi poczty elektronicznej

·        czytniki RSS i Atom

·        funkcja szybkiego wybierania stron (ang. speed dial)

·        wbudowany klient BitTorrent

·        tryb prywatny

 

 

Silnik przeglądarki internetowej (ang. layout engine lub rendering engine) — silnik wyświetlania (tzw. renderowania) stron internetowych wykorzystywany głównie przez przeglądarki internetowe. Jest oprogramowaniem odpowiadającym za przetwarzanie zawartości stron internetowych (kod HTML, XHTML, grafika, skrypty) oraz ich elementów formatujących (arkusze CSS i XSL), a następnie renderowanie rezultatu.

Termin „silnik przeglądarki internetowej” stał się szczególnie popularny z chwilą opublikowania przez Mozilla Foundation silnika Gecko jako komponentu, dostępnego niezależnie od przeglądarki.

Najpopularniejszym silnikiem, ze względu na procent internautów korzystających z używającej go przeglądarki, jest Trident dla Internet Explorera. Powszechnie znana jest jego niedoskonałość w obsłudze technologii takich jak CSS czy PNG, zbyt duża tolerancja błędów w kodzie czy powolne renderowanie stron.

Poszczególne silniki renderujące różnią się od siebie, co może doprowadzić do sytuacji, w której jedna strona wygląda inaczej w różnych przeglądarkach.